JOB SUMMARY/OBJECTIVE:

The Digital Communications Specialist assumes a pivotal role in developing and managing digital communication strategies to enhance the visibility and engagement of the healthcare organization. This role involves creating and optimizing digital content across various platforms, managing social media, and implementing digital marketing campaigns to support patient education, brand awareness, and organizational goals. With a strong expertise in digital media and strategic communication, the Digital Communications Specialist significantly contributes to advancing Choctaw Premier Services’ objectives, driving impactful engagement, and supporting overall success.

PRIMARY RESPONSIBILITIES:

  • Develop and produce engaging content for digital platforms including websites, social media, blogs, and email newsletters.
  • Ensure that content is accurate, relevant, and aligned with healthcare regulations and organizational guidelines.
  • Manage social media accounts (e.g., Facebook, Twitter, LinkedIn, Instagram), including content scheduling, community engagement, and performance monitoring.
  • Create social media campaigns promoting healthcare services, events, and initiatives.
  • Plan and execute digital marketing campaigns to drive traffic, increase engagement, and support healthcare marketing objectives.
  • Analyze campaign performance and adjust strategies based on data and insights.
  • Oversee the maintenance and optimization of the organization’s website, ensuring content is up-to-date and user-friendly.
  • Collaborate with web developers to implement design updates and enhancements.
  • Monitor and analyze digital communication metrics and key performance indicators (KPIs) to evaluate the effectiveness of campaigns and content.
  • Prepare regular reports on digital communication performance and provide actionable recommendations for improvement.
  • Develop strategies to enhance patient engagement and education through digital channels.
  • Create content that addresses patient needs, promotes health literacy, and supports patient retention.
  • Ensure all digital communications comply with healthcare regulations (e.g., HIPAA) and organizational policies.
  • Remain current concerning digital marketing trends and best practices to implement innovative strategies.
